2. File Integrity
File integrity, in the context of acquiring the specified digital game, refers to the assurance that the downloaded files are complete, unaltered, and free from corruption or malicious modification. Maintaining file integrity is paramount for ensuring the game functions correctly, without errors or instability, and does not introduce security vulnerabilities to the user’s system.
-
Checksum Verification
Checksum verification involves calculating a unique numerical value (a checksum) based on the contents of a file. This checksum is then compared against a known, valid checksum provided by a trusted source. If the calculated checksum matches the provided checksum, it confirms that the file has not been tampered with. For the digital game, verifying the checksum of the downloaded ISO image or executable files is essential to ensure their authenticity and completeness.
-
Digital Signatures
Digital signatures provide a higher level of assurance than checksums. They utilize cryptographic techniques to verify both the authenticity and integrity of a file. A digital signature is created by the software developer or distributor using a private key, and it can be verified using a corresponding public key. If a file has been altered after being digitally signed, the signature will no longer be valid. Checking for a valid digital signature on the game’s installer or executable files is a strong indicator of file integrity.

4. Installation Process
The installation process, when considered in the context of procuring the digital game, comprises a series of technical steps required to transfer the downloaded files onto a computer system and prepare them for execution. Its proper execution is crucial for ensuring the game runs without errors and that all features function as intended.
-
Extraction of Files
Many distributions of the game, particularly those acquired from online sources, are compressed into archive formats (e.g., ISO, ZIP, RAR) to reduce file size and facilitate efficient transfer. The initial step frequently involves extracting these compressed files using appropriate software. Failure to correctly extract the archive can lead to incomplete or corrupted game files, rendering the installation process unsuccessful. For instance, an incomplete ISO extraction might result in a missing asset folder, preventing the game from launching.
-
Mounting ISO Images (if applicable)
If the downloaded file is in ISO format, it typically represents a disc image. To proceed with the installation, the ISO image must be mounted as a virtual drive using software such as Daemon Tools or similar utilities. Mounting the image makes the contents accessible to the operating system as if a physical disc were inserted into a drive. Skipping this step or using incompatible mounting software will prevent the installation program from accessing the game files. An incorrect mount, perhaps due to software conflict, might generate an error message indicating the absence of the installation medium.
-
Executing the Installer
The core of the installation process involves running the setup executable, which is typically found within the extracted files or mounted ISO image. The installer guides the user through a series of prompts, including selecting the installation directory, configuring optional components, and agreeing to licensing terms. Interrupting the installer or providing incorrect information can result in a partial or failed installation. Prematurely ending the setup process, due to impatience or perceived delays, might leave the game in an inoperable state.
